I'm glad I discovered this product for a lot of reasons. First and foremost, this oil is clean and nontoxic. That means it's made without fragrance, parabens, added color, phthalates, PEGs, mineral oil, or anything synthetic, and it's cruelty-free. Through trial and error over the last couple years, I've learned that my skin is sensitive to a lot of ingredients, and if I was going to invest in a facial oil, I wanted it to be free of any "bad" ingredients that could cause irritation. Knowing that McNamara is extremely serious about her own clean beauty routine, I trusted her list of carefully sourced ingredients.

Smoothing this all over your face is like giving your dry skin the most thirst-quenching drink of its life.

Never mind what's not in this oil — let's talk about what is. Moringa is a superfood that is loaded with nutrients, antioxidants, and vitamins A, B, C, D, and E. It has more vitamin C than oranges, I was told when I bought the oil at Credo Beauty. A blend of plankton extract and algae is packed with fatty acids that plump and hydrate dull skin. I use about a half dropper full of Mara Universal Face Oil ($72) under my makeup every day, and almost a full dropper at night. I splash it into the palm of my hand and then dab the oil all over my face, pressing it in so it penetrates. It's so hydrating that I've never seen a flake of dryness throughout the day or in the morning after using this.

It's Makeup Artist Approved

I could watch Katie Jane Hughes do her makeup for hours. The Instagram-famous makeup artist and queen of glossy skin shares tutorials and product recommendations regularly, and she vouches for Mara's Universal Face Oil, too. She mixes a drop or two with concealer on the back of her hand and blends it out with a brush for dewy, light coverage all over.
